dc.description.abstractThis article considers the heat and humidity change laws during the year at the highways foot and the water-heat regime processes in it. The heat and humidity order at the road foot was studied, and the research results on the specific heat capacity of the soil, the freezing depth depends on its salinity, elevation, salt amount and quality
